Color Desire #EA3C53 Meaning

Desire (#EA3C53)

Desire (#EA3C53) signifies targeted passion, urgent attraction, and modern craving. This bright, pure red with a slight pink undertone is the color of a beating heart exposed, ripe strawberries, and alarm signals. Psychologically, Desire (#EA3C53) stimulates immediate wanting, focused excitement, and a sense of dynamic, magnetic pull.

It culturally references modern advertising, dating app icons, and the vibrant flush of intense emotion. Spiritually, this color represents the pure pulse of yearning, the focused will to connect or possess, and life force in its most direct and urgent form, acting as a powerful catalyst for action and pursuit.

Contrast Checker WCAG 2.1

Test Desire #EA3C53 for accessibility compliance against white and black backgrounds. Proper contrast ensures #EA3C53 remains readable and usable for all audiences, meeting WCAG 2.1 standards for both normal and large text applications.

WCAG Guidelines: Text should have a minimum contrast ratio of 4.5:1 for normal text and 3:1 for large text (18pt+ or bold 14pt+).
